WebStrike water volume = weight of grain X Desired mash thickness . Example 1. Mash thickness of 1.25qts/pound with a grain bill of 10lbs would result in a strike water volume … WebStep Two: Mix the Mash. WebThe mash temperature is the temperature of the water used for mashing grains that produce the fermentable sugars for beer. Generally, the higher the temperature, the higher the efficiency. Temperatures that are too low can lead to under-modified starches, resulting in poor conversion efficiency. On the other hand, having a mash temperature that ... WebMay 29, 2024 · Combine the grain addition e.g. cornmeal with boiling water. Mix thoroughly and aim for a mash temp of 158-194F. Let the mash cool to about 150F and then add the diastatic barley malt powder or whole grain rye flour to the mash, mixing thoroughly. The act of mixing will bring the mash to the desired 145-149F temperature.
